Cats often prefer to lay on the floor because it provides them with a sense of security and stability. The firm and stable surface of the floor allows them to feel grounded and in control of their surroundings, which can help them relax and feel safe. Additionally, the floor may be cooler than elevated surfaces, making it more comfortable for them to rest.
